About this ebook

Greg is worried about his best friend Kyle. Kyle's life seems to be spiraling out of control. Greg doesn't mind picking up the pieces, but his normally smart, ambitious and good-looking friend seems more distracted than usual after his last break-up. And he's starting to get annoyed at Greg trying to lend him a hand. 

What Greg doesn't realize is that Kyle is keeping something from him... and it could change both of their lives forever.
